Mariyah

  • Origin
    Arabic
  • Meaning
    The name Mariyah is derived from the Arabic word "مريم" (Maryam), which is the Arabic name for Mary, the mother of Jesus in Christian tradition. Mariyah means "beloved," "cherished," or "exalted."
  • Variations
    Maryam, Maria, Mary, Mariam
  • Similar names
    Aaliyah, Zariyah, Amiyah
